The MSc International Finance is a fifteen-month, full-time Master of Science programme taught in English, designed to equip students with the skills that match the current needs of the finance industry.
This Master of Science offers students a unique opportunity to acquire the latest knowledge developments and their practical application through case studies and business games, as well as a mandatory four-month professional experience that allows them to build solid skills.

1-year course: 4-year Bachelor’s degree or 3-year Bachelor’s degree with a minimum of 1 year professional experience
2-year course: 3-year Bachelor’s degree
Candidates should demonstrate interest in investing in a future career in finance via certifications, courses, etc. They should ideally have a finance-related background or business background with quantitative knowledge and skills.
Candidates should be able to communicate with confidence in English, participate in group work, demonstrate initiative, strong interpersonal skills, enjoy meeting people and having new experiences.
Applications are accepted on a rolling basis, from September 2023 with a final deadline for submissions in mid-July 2024. Applicants will be informed of the admission jury’s decision two weeks following the interview.
However, given the limited number of places, candidates are advised to apply as early as possible.

For many years now, NEOMA has been committed to promoting all forms of diversity, which can be seen in its ambitious grant policy.
For international students admitted into eligible programmes, this excellence scholarship policy supports students throughout their education.
This scholarship grants up to 2500 euros discount on the 1st year tuition fees.
You can obtain up to 4000 euros discount on the tuition fees.
MSc International Luxury Management does not apply to this scholarship.
